Once generated, I• offers unique reactivity compared with traditional acyl radicals. Due in part to delocalization into the carbene, these captodative radicals demonstrate increased stability and allow for selective radical cross-coupling with transient partners [ 12].

Org. Chem., 2003, 68, 9453-9455. Aldehydes are safely and conveniently converted to acyl azides and benzyl ethers to azido ethers by treatment with polymer supported iodine azide in MeCN at 83 °C. The reaction provides an alternative to the use of iodine azide in radical azidonations.

WebSep 24, 2024 · Their low reactivity makes the easy to work with and they are stable enough to be used as a solvent in organic reactions (ex. ethyl acetate). Esters are still reactive enough to undergo hydrolysis to form carboxylic acids, alcoholysis, to form different esters, and aminolysis to form amides.

Acyl phosphates, because they are so reactive towards acyl substitutions, are generally seen as reaction intermediates rather than stable metabolites in biochemical pathways. Acyl phosphates usually take one of two forms: a simple acyl monophosphate, or acyl-adenosine monophosphate.
